Rubber roof rep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ues related to rubber roofing systems, which are commonly used on flat or low-slope roofs. These repairs may include patching holes, sealing cracks, and replacing damaged sections to restore the roof’s integrity. Skilled service providers utilize specialized materials and techniques to ensure that repairs are durable and weather-resistant, helping to extend the lifespan of the rubber roofing system.
One of the primary problems addressed by rubber roof repair is the development of leaks caused by punctures, tears, or deterioration over time. Exposure to the elements, such as UV rays, temperature fluctuations, and moisture, can weaken rubber membranes, leading to potential water intrusion. Repair services help prevent further damage by sealing these vulnerabilities, thereby protecting the interior of the property from water damage and mold growth.

Material and Size Costs - The cost of rubber roof repair varies based on the size and material quality, typically ranging from $500 to $2,500. Smaller repairs may cost around $500, while larger sections can reach up to $2,500 or more.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for rubber roof repairs generally fall between $300 and $1,200, depending on the complexity of the job. More extensive repairs or difficult access can increase labor charges within this range.
Additional Materials - Extra materials such as sealants, patches, or adhesives may add $100 to $400 to the total cost. These expenses depend on the extent of the damage and specific repair needs.
Overall Cost Factors - Overall costs can vary based on roof size, damage severity, and local contractor rates, with typical repair projects falling between $800 and $3,000. Contact local pros for precise estimates tailored to specific repair requ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my rubber roof needs repairs? Signs such as cracks, blisters, ponding water, or noticeable leaks can indicate the need for repairs. Consulting with a local roofing professional can help assess the condition of the roof.
What types of repairs are common for rubber roofs? Common repairs include patching leaks, sealing cracks, replacing damaged sections, and addressing ponding water issues. A local contractor can recommend the best approach based on the roof’s condition.
How long do rubber roof repairs typically last? Repair longevity depends on the extent of damage and the quality of work performed. A professional service provider can provide guidance on maintenance and future repair needs.
Can rubber roofs be repaired without complete replacement? Yes, many issues can be addressed through targeted repairs, avoiding the need for full roof replacement. Contact a local roofing expert to evaluate the repair options.
